    What are the best things to do in Boulder?

    +

    Boulder pairs Flatirons hiking and climbing with Pearl Street food and brewery walks, e-bike tours along Boulder Creek and Rocky Mountain National Park day trips.     When is the best time to visit Boulder?

    +

    May to October. Booking patterns follow the same curve: prices and queues climb in peak weeks, while shoulder season gives you better availability on the top-ranked experiences and more room to change plans.
